Brennan Investment Group (BIG), a privately held industrial real estate investment firm focused on acquiring, developing, and managing industrial properties in key metropolitan areas across the United States, is in search of an Assistant Property Manager. This role is integral to the effective management and financial performance of designated properties within the Texas industrial sector, adhering to the company's policies, procedures, and standards to ensure optimal service delivery and quality outcomes.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Foster and maintain strong relationships with clients and service providers, ensuring proactive and responsive engagement with their needs.
  • Oversee property revenues and expenditures, employing sound financial practices to meet budgetary and financial objectives.
  • Ensure tenants are up-to-date with their payments and lease obligations.
  • Manage collections and coordinate necessary actions for default situations.
  • Engage with vendors to facilitate the timely completion of maintenance requests.
  • Assist in the formulation and execution of operational and capital budgets.
  • Establish and manage estimated versus actual recoveries.
  • Collaborate with the accounting team to reconcile operating expenses, ensuring a thorough understanding of lease agreements.
  • Oversee the real estate tax review process and communicate any tax-related concerns to senior management.
  • Ensure compliance with insurance requirements for properties and related vendors.
  • Manage accounts payable and receivable invoicing processes for the property portfolio.
  • Support the Managing Principal in achieving occupancy targets through exceptional customer service and relationship management, thereby enhancing tenant retention rates.
  • Address and resolve complaints, disturbances, and violations effectively.
  • Ensure adherence to property management policies, regulations, and governmental directives, maintaining compliance with all legal requirements and company standards.
  • Coordinate environmental initiatives for assigned properties.
  • Facilitate the annual customer satisfaction survey for properties.
  • Manage lease administration processes, ensuring timely updates for any changes in leases.
  • Oversee the customer move-in and move-out processes, ensuring a seamless experience for all parties involved.
  • Adhere to established company and legal protocols concerning default proceedings and evictions.
  • Conduct regular site inspections to verify that properties meet established standards for safety, cleanliness, and overall appearance, implementing corrective actions as necessary.
  • Solicit bids from contractors for various projects and oversee their work to ensure compliance with service agreements.
  • Collaborate with other departments to plan and coordinate maintenance, repairs, and capital improvement projects.
  • Manage customer and building improvement projects, ensuring quality and timely completion.
  • Act as a liaison between clients and construction management, participating in project walkthroughs and follow-ups.
  • Work with various departments to resolve property management challenges.
  • Analyze market and economic data to inform property management strategies.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's Degree from an accredited institution.
  • 1-3 years of experience in property management is required.
  • Experience in industrial or commercial real estate is essential.
  • Ability to maintain a professional demeanor consistently.
  • Exceptional customer service skills, with strong diplomacy and crisis management abilities.
  • Proficient in multitasking, prioritizing, and working independently with minimal supervision, demonstrating strong attention to detail and time management skills.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with proficiency in internet usage, spreadsheets, databases, and word processing software.
  • Strong working knowledge of Microsoft Office applications (e.g.,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ook).
  • Good mathematical and analytical capabilities.
  • Familiarity with property management accounting software is preferred.
  • A valid driver's license and the ability to travel to various properties are required.
  • Flexibility to work extended hours as business needs dictate.
  • Experience with MRI software is a plus.
  • Membership in professional real estate organizations (e.g., BOMA, IREM) is preferred.
